musicadi OK, now that is intriguing and I can partially repro that.
My repro results are a little different, but still unexpected.
Build 2135 on my 9th Gen iPad (iOS26.1.0) in portrait mode.
- Open sidebar and create an empty Playlist
- Go into the empty Playlist
- Close ST4
- Open ST4
Observations:
- ST4 never opens with the empty Playlist visible, it always opens 1 level up at my root folder level showing a list of Playlists.
- The sidebar right border 'creeps' a little to the right every single time. Just a bit, but it is visible if you are watching for it.

Now, on the sidebar border movement, I suspected that we might be seeing an initial default position on app open, then a re-draw based on 'last known position'?
I tested this theory by:
- setting the sidebar quite narrow and open/closing (sidebar seemed to open 'wide' then become narrow)
- setting the sidebar quite wide and open/closing (sidebar seemed to open 'normal' then become wide)
So... the sidebar position change could be either a visible re-draw effect, or it could actually be creeping from last stored position, I'm not ruling out either.
What I am definitely seeing consistently is that the sidebar will never seem to open into an empty Playlist. Very much as edge case and pretty minor impact so really a low priority issue.
